As of August 2026, a American Airlines AAdvantage is worth about 1.77 US cents per mile toward typical redemptions. That makes 50,000 miles worth roughly $885. This free calculator converts any American Airlines AAdvantage balance into its USD value. Actual value depends on how you redeem; premium-cabin awards often beat economy.

Good value
3.10¢ per mile
A Web Special business class fare to Europe booked off-peak, for example JFK to Madrid in business for 57,500 miles one-way against a $2,200 cash fare.
Typical value
1.65¢ per mile
A domestic saver-level economy round trip, for example a transcontinental JFK to LAX ticket for 25,000 miles against a $415 cash fare.
Poor value
0.65¢ per mile
Redeeming miles for magazine subscriptions or gift-card merchandise through the AAdvantage eShopping mall.

American rebuilt its elite qualification system in 2022 around a single running score called Loyalty Points, retiring the old Elite Qualifying Miles, Segments, and Dollars trio entirely. Every dollar of eligible spend and every qualifying flight now feeds the same counter, whether it came from flying, the co-brand card portfolio, or shopping and dining partners, which makes AAdvantage one of the more spend-friendly programmes for reaching Gold, Platinum, Platinum Pro, or Executive Platinum without a single long-haul trip. On the redemption side, Web Specials are AAdvantage discounted saver awards released on a rotating list of routes, often the single best way to stretch a mid-size balance into a premium-cabin seat. American also sits inside the oneworld alliance, so an AAdvantage balance can book Cathay Pacific, Qatar Airways, and Qantas award seats directly through the AA website at AA mileage pricing, a shortcut that avoids creating a separate account with each partner airline just to check availability.

The cents-per-mile values below are drawn from The Points Guy monthly valuations and NerdWallet's Avios analysis. They represent typical redemption value, not a guaranteed rate. Actual value depends on the redemption you choose; premium-cabin awards often yield significantly more than economy redemptions. The blended valuations in the table below are anchored to The Points Guy's monthly valuations, an industry-standard aggregator, while the programme-specific mechanics discussed in this guide link directly to each programme's own terms.
| Programme | Unit | Typical value (cents per mile/point) | Source |
|---|---|---|---|
| American Airlines AAdvantage | mile | 1.77¢ | The Points Guy AAdvantage valuation |
| Delta SkyMiles | mile | 1.20¢ | The Points Guy SkyMiles valuation |
| United MileagePlus | mile | 1.35¢ | The Points Guy MileagePlus valuation |
| Chase Ultimate Rewards | point | 2.00¢ | The Points Guy Ultimate Rewards valuation |
| American Express Membership Rewards | point | 2.00¢ | The Points Guy Membership Rewards valuation |
| Citi ThankYou Rewards | point | 1.80¢ | The Points Guy ThankYou Rewards valuation |
| Capital One Miles | mile | 1.85¢ | The Points Guy Capital One Miles valuation |
| Marriott Bonvoy | point | 0.84¢ | The Points Guy Bonvoy valuation |
| Hilton Honors | point | 0.60¢ | The Points Guy Hilton Honors valuation |
| World of Hyatt | point | 1.70¢ | The Points Guy Hyatt valuation |
| British Airways Executive Club Avios | Avios | 1.50¢ | NerdWallet Avios valuation |
| Air France/KLM Flying Blue | mile | 1.30¢ | The Points Guy Flying Blue valuation |
| Southwest Rapid Rewards | point | 1.40¢ | The Points Guy Southwest valuation |
| Air Canada Aeroplan | point | 1.45¢ | The Points Guy Aeroplan valuation |
| Bilt Rewards | point | 2.20¢ | The Points Guy Bilt Rewards valuation |
